Active toys for 3-year-olds

Girl on a toy horse

Toddlers are bursting with energy. They want to explore, move around, and above all, play! That’s why active toys are ideal for 3-year-olds. They help them burn off that endless energy and stimulate their motor skills and imagination.

Active toys help children become more independent by allowing them to choose what they play with and explore at their own pace. This helps children discover their interests and encourages them to develop new skills in a focused way. Active toys also have an educational aspect: they’re not only fun but also designed to help children develop important skills.

Jumping, Crawling, and Balancing

In addition to riding, 3-year-olds also love to jump, run, and climb. A small indoor trampoline with a safety bar is a good example of a safe and active toy. Balance stones or a balance beam also help improve motor skills and train balance.

A play mat with obstacles or a crawling tunnel can also be transformed into a mini-adventure course, where children can run as part of the physical challenge. Completing such a course not only stimulates children’s motor skills but also their concentration. This turns any living room into an active playground.

Playing outside with balance bikes and scooters

Is the weather nice outside? Then a balance bike is the perfect active outdoor toy for 3-year-olds. They learn to balance, steer, and move around faster than they can on foot. A scooter or a small tricycle is also perfect for exploring on their own, with or without a parent’s supervision.

In addition to balance bikes and scooters, there are many other popular types of outdoor toys for young children, such as sidewalk chalk, soccer balls, playing with sand in the sandbox, and swinging on a swing. There’s a large collection and a wide variety of outdoor toys available for children ages 3 and up, so there’s always something fun to choose from.

Outdoor toys are also a fun and educational gift for children of this age. Playing outside with active toys helps children prepare for school by helping them develop their motor and social skills.

Safety and Sustainability of Active Toys

As a parent, you naturally want your child to be able to play safely and carefree. That’s why it’s important to pay close attention to the safety and durability of products when choosing active toys. Always choose toys that are specifically designed for children ages 3 and up, and check to make sure they meet current safety standards. For example, look for rounded corners, sturdy construction, and the absence of small parts that could be swallowed.

Sustainability also plays a major role. Toys that last for years aren’t just easier on your wallet—they’re also better for the environment. When shopping, look for materials that are durable and thoughtfully selected, such as sturdy wood or high-quality plastic. That way, you can be sure the toys can withstand rough play and be used by multiple children. By choosing durable and safe toys, you give your child the freedom to develop through play, while you, as a parent, can watch with peace of mind as your child discovers new things and grows.

Playing Together: Developing Social Skills

Playing isn’t just fun—it’s also an important opportunity to develop social skills. When children play with friends, brothers, or sisters, they learn through play how to share, work together, and be considerate of one another. Whether they’re building a train set together, acting out a story with dolls, or organizing a race with toy vehicles—every play session offers opportunities to practice communication and resolve minor conflicts.

Parents can encourage this by inviting children to play together and guiding them as they make agreements or divide up tasks. In this way, children learn in various ways to express their feelings, listen to others, and work together to find solutions. By playing together with building sets, dolls, or toy vehicles, children not only develop their social skills but also build friendships and self-confidence. Through play, they grow into independent and social preschoolers!
